namespace chromeos {
namespace {
// Checks the |event| and asynchronously sets the XKB layout when necessary.
void HandleHierarchyChangedEvent(XIHierarchyEvent* event) {
if (!(event->flags & (XISlaveAdded | XISlaveRemoved)))
return;
bool update_keyboard_status = false;
for (int i = 0; i < event->num_info; ++i) {
XIHierarchyInfo* info = &event->info[i];
if ((info->flags & XISlaveAdded) && (info->use == XIFloatingSlave)) {
update_keyboard_status = true;
break;
}
}
if (update_keyboard_status) {
chromeos::input_method::InputMethodManager* input_method_manager =
chromeos::input_method::InputMethodManager::Get();
chromeos::input_method::ImeKeyboard* keyboard =
input_method_manager->GetImeKeyboard();
keyboard->ReapplyCurrentModifierLockStatus();
keyboard->ReapplyCurrentKeyboardLayout();
}
}
